A local Fine Gael TD says some opposition parties have been 'playing to the crowd' following recent fuel protests. Longford-Westmeath TD Micheál Carrigy has been speaking after a turbulent couple of weeks for Government which saw Michael Healy-Rae resign as a Junior Minister.
They introduced further cuts to excise on petrol and diesel last week however some opposition parties have remained critical of their approach. Deputy Carrigy says they're calling for measures that can't be implemented:
